Problem

Current treatments for neuroinflammatory and neuropsychiatric disorders often have limited efficacy and significant side effects. Traditional drug discovery methods are costly and time-consuming, hindering the development of novel therapeutic interventions.

Solution

Huxley Health is a biotechnology company focused on developing psychedelic-inspired therapeutics for nervous system disorders. The company leverages a targeted, capital-efficient research approach, enhanced by AI, to identify and develop novel compounds and formulations. By partnering with leading research institutions, Huxley Health aims to accelerate the discovery and delivery of groundbreaking therapies for neuroinflammatory and neuropsychiatric conditions. Their approach focuses on maximizing R&D efficiency while reducing traditional costs associated with drug development.
